Thermal Imaging Leak Detection v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ak under the sink | Yes | No | You can fix it yourself with some basic plumbing skills and tools. |
| Hidden leak behind a wall | No | Yes | You’ll need specialized equipment and training to detect and fix the leak. |
| Water damage from a burst pipe | No | Yes | You’ll need to contain the damage and dry out the affected area quickly to prevent further damage. |
| Water stains on the ceiling | No | Yes | You’ll need to identify and fix the source of the leak to prevent further damage. |
| Unexplained puddles or water spots | No | Yes | You’ll need to detect and fix the hidden leak to prevent further damage. |
| Increased water bills | No | Yes | You’ll need to identify and fix the hidden leak to prevent further damage and save on your water bill. |

Thermal Imaging Leak Detection Cost in Parma, OH
The cost of Thermal Imaging Leak Detection in Parma, OH will v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ates typically range from $500 to $2,500.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Moisture detection |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and severity of the leak |
| Leak location | $100 – $500 | Complexity of the leak and equipment needed |
| Containment |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and materials needed |
|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area and equipment needed |
| Cleanup and rep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Severity of the damage and materials needed |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ates and transparent pricing so you know what to expect.
